Legacy Conversion

As computing power has increased over the years, CAD software has made quantum improvements in capabilities. Many companies have taken advantage of this and migrated to new CAD and data management systems to improve productivity. This has created large amounts of engineering data being locked up in legacy systems. UFT offers a very low cost option to convert the legacy engineering designs and drawings to the new CAD systems. UFT has extensive experience in working with AutoCAD, Catia, Pro-E, Solid Works, Inventor, and Unigraphics. UFT can convert drawings from one system to other, or from hard copy, tiff, or pdf to 3D models and 2D drawings in any of the CAD systems.

Solid models give clarity to design, which is otherwise not possible with 2D drawings. Our engineers can convert your legacy design information and data into parametric, feature-based fully associative 3D CAD models. With the software technology available today, 3D digital solid modeling offers unprecedented possibilities for improving designs and cutting costs.
